Comment[GEAAccession] E-GEAD-363 MAGE-TAB Version 1.1 Investigation Title Transcriptome dataset of human corneal endothelium Experiment Description A transcriptome dataset from ribosomal RNA-depleted total RNA of corneal endothelium from the eyes derived from seven Caucasians without ocular diseases. Cornea endothelium is one of the five different layers of cornea. As corneal endothelium has limited proliferative capacity, damage to corneal endothelium by multiple pathological conditions, such as Fuchs endothelial corneal dystrophy (FECD; OMIM ID: 204870), invasive cataract surgery, glaucoma surgery, and endotheliitis, induce loss of corneal transparency resulting in severe visual disturbance. Therefore, the dataset should be useful for investigating the function/dysfunction of cornea as well as for the extended transcriptome analyses integrated with the data of non-coding RNAs.
